如何在AI陪聊软件中创建智能对话流程

在一个繁忙的都市,李明是一名软件工程师,他的生活充满了代码和算法。作为一名AI技术爱好者,李明一直对如何创造一个能够理解人类情感、提供个性化服务的AI陪聊软件充满好奇。经过数月的钻研和试验,他终于开发出了一款具有智能对话流程的陪聊软件。以下是李明创建这款软件的故事。

李明从小就对计算机有着浓厚的兴趣,大学毕业后,他进入了一家知名的科技公司,从事人工智能研发工作。在工作中,他接触到了许多前沿的AI技术,但让他印象最深刻的,还是那些能够与人类进行自然对话的AI系统。

“我总是想象,如果有一个AI能够真正理解我,与我分享喜怒哀乐,那该多好。”李明在一次团队会议上这样说道。

然而,市场上的AI陪聊软件大多存在一些问题,比如对话内容单一、缺乏情感共鸣、无法提供个性化服务等。这激发了他想要创造一款真正能够满足用户需求的AI陪聊软件。

为了实现这个目标,李明开始了漫长的研发之路。他首先研究了大量的自然语言处理(NLP)技术,包括词性标注、句法分析、语义理解等。通过这些技术,AI可以更好地理解用户的意图和情感。

接下来,李明开始构建对话流程。他首先将对话流程分为几个阶段:问候、了解用户需求、提供个性化服务、结束对话。在每个阶段,他又细分出了多个子流程,以确保对话的流畅性和连贯性。

以下是李明创建智能对话流程的详细步骤:

  1. 用户注册与登录

    • 用户通过手机号码或邮箱注册账号。
    • 用户登录后,系统会自动识别用户的设备信息,以便提供更加个性化的服务。
  2. 问候阶段

    • 系统首先向用户发出问候,询问用户的心情和需求。
    • 如果用户没有明确表达,系统会根据用户的历史数据,推测用户可能的需求。
  3. 了解用户需求

    • 系统通过提问的方式,引导用户表达自己的需求。
    • 如果用户的需求比较模糊,系统会通过一系列的问题,帮助用户明确自己的需求。
  4. 提供个性化服务

    • 根据用户的需求,系统会提供相应的服务,如推荐音乐、书籍、电影等。
    • 系统还会根据用户的喜好,调整推荐内容,以提供更加个性化的服务。
  5. 情感共鸣

    • 在对话过程中,系统会通过情感分析技术,识别用户的情绪变化。
    • 当用户表达不满或悲伤时,系统会及时调整对话策略,提供安慰和支持。
  6. 结束对话

    • 当用户的需求得到满足后,系统会礼貌地结束对话,询问用户是否需要其他帮助。
    • 如果用户表示满意,系统会记录此次对话,以便后续优化。

在实现这些功能的过程中,李明遇到了许多挑战。例如,如何让AI更好地理解用户的情感,如何让对话更加自然流畅,如何保证系统的安全性等。为了解决这些问题,李明查阅了大量资料,与同行交流,甚至请教了心理学专家。

经过数月的努力,李明的AI陪聊软件终于上线了。他邀请了一些朋友和同事试用,收集反馈。大家普遍认为,这款软件能够很好地理解用户的需求,提供个性化的服务,并且在情感共鸣方面做得相当出色。

“这是我见过最接近人类的AI陪聊软件。”一位试用者评价道。

李明的软件很快在市场上获得了良好的口碑,吸引了越来越多的用户。他感到非常欣慰,因为他知道,自己的努力没有白费。

然而,李明并没有因此而满足。他深知,AI技术还在不断发展,未来的路还很长。他计划继续优化软件,引入更多先进的技术,比如语音识别、图像识别等,让AI陪聊软件更加智能化、人性化。

“我希望,我的这款软件能够成为人们生活中的良师益友,陪伴他们度过每一个孤独的时刻。”李明满怀信心地说道。

这个故事告诉我们,只要有梦想和坚持,每个人都可以成为改变世界的创造者。李明通过自己的努力,将AI技术应用于实际生活中,为人们带来了便利和温暖。这正是人工智能的魅力所在,也是我们这个时代最宝贵的财富。

猜你喜欢:AI语音